You cannot select more than 25 topics
			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
		
		
		
		
		
			
		
			
				
	
	
	
		
			3.5 KiB
		
	
	
	
			
		
		
	
	
			3.5 KiB
		
	
	
	
Changelog
master
- upgrade to new version of 
tmux-test - bug: when using 
emacscopy mode, Enter does not quit screen after tpm installation/update. Fix by makingEscapethe key for emacs mode. - add a doc with troubleshooting instructions
 - add 
.gitattributesfile that forces linefeed characters (classic\n) as line endings - helps with misconfigured git on windows/cygwin - readme update: announce Cygwin support
 - un-deprecate old plugin definition syntax: 
set -g @tpm_plugins 
v3.0.0, 2015-08-03
- refactor 
shared_set_tpm_path_constantfunction - move all instructions to 
docs/dir - add 
bin/install_pluginscli executable script - improved test runner function
 - switch to using tmux-test framework
 - add 
bin/update_pluginscli executable script - refactor test 
expectscripts, make them simpler and ensure they properly assert expectations - refactor code that sets 'TMUX_PLUGIN_MANAGER_PATH' global env var
 - stop using global variable for 'tpm path'
 - support defining plugins via 
set -g @pluginin sourced files as well 
v2.0.0, 2015-07-07
- enable overriding default key bindings
 - start using 
C-cto clear screen - add uninstall/clean procedure and keybinding (prefix+alt+u) (@chilicuil)
 - add new 
set @plugin 'repo'plugin definition syntax (@chilicuil) - revert back to using 
-gflag in new plugin definition syntax - permit leading whitespace with new plugin definition syntax (thanks @chilicuil)
 - make sure 
TMUX_PLUGIN_MANAGER_PATHalways has trailng slash - ensure old/deprecated plugin syntax 
set -g @tpm_pluginsworks alongside newset -g @pluginsyntax 
v1.2.2, 2015-02-08
- set GIT_TERMINAL_PROMPT=0 when doing 
git clone,pullorsubmodule updateto ensure git does not prompt for username/password in any case 
v1.2.1, 2014-11-21
- change the way plugin name is expanded. It now uses the http username
and password by default, like this: 
https://git::@github.com/. This prevents username and password prompt (and subsequently tmux install hanging) with old git versions. Fixes #7. 
v1.2.0, 2014-11-20
- refactor tests so they can be used on travis
 - add travis.yml, add travis badge to the readme
 
v1.1.0, 2014-11-19
- if the plugin is not downloaded do not source it
 - remove 
PLUGINS.md, an obsolete list of plugins - update readme with instructions about uninstalling plugins
 - tilde char and 
$HOMEinTMUX_SHARED_MANAGER_PATHcouldn't be used because they are just plain strings. Fixing the problem by manually expanding them. - bugfix: fragile 
*.tmuxfile globbing (@majutsushi) 
v1.0.0, 2014-08-05
- update readme because of github organization change to tmux-plugins
 - update tests to pass
 - update README to suggest different first plugin
 - update list of plugins in the README
 - remove README 'about' section
 - move key binding to the main file. Delete 
key_binding.sh. - rename 
display_message->echo_message - installing plugins installs just new plugins. Already installed plugins aren't updated.
 - add 'update plugin' binding and functionality
 - add test for updating a plugin
 
v0.0.2, 2014-07-17
- run all *.tmux plugin files as executables
 - fix all redirects to /dev/null
 - fix bug: TPM shared path is created before sync (cloning plugins from github is done)
 - add test suite running in Vagrant
 - add Tmux version check. 
TPMwon't run if Tmux version is less than 1.9. 
v0.0.1, 2014-05-21
- get TPM up and running